Transponder Codes

The name implies that a transponder sends out an encoded signal that contains the four-digit code when it is questioned by air traffic control. This signal is called the SQUAWK code and forms the basis for aircraft identification on radar screens. It is also used to send a specific message to the air traffic control system in a crisis or to inform controllers of changes in weather conditions. Squawk codes are often employed to communicate with ATC in situations where the pilot cannot speak on the radio, and are very important to ensure safe flying.

Every aircraft is equipped with a transponder that responds to radar probes by displaying an identifier. This enables ATC to locate an aircraft that is surrounded by screens. Transponders come in a variety of modes that vary in how they respond to questions. Mode A is the only mode that transmits the code, whereas mode C also contains altitude information. Mode S transponders offer more specific information like call signs and position which are useful in airspace that is crowded.

Most aircraft have a tiny beige-colored box beneath the seat of the pilot. The transponder is a tiny beige box that is used to transmit the SQUAWK code when air traffic control activates the aircraft. The transponder can be set to the 'ON', the ALT, or the SBY (standby position) positions.

Air traffic control will typically instruct a pilot to "squawk the ident". This is a directive for the pilot to press the IDENT button on their transponder. The ident button makes the aircraft blink on ATC radar screens and allows them to identify your aircraft on the screen.

There are 63 distinct code blocks that can be assigned to an aircraft. However, there are reserved codes that prevent the use of certain codes in areas with high traffic or during emergencies. The discrete code blocks are set up by statistical analysis to reduce the chance that two aircrafts with identical SQUAWK codes will be in the same sector at any given time.

PIN codes

A PIN code is a collection of numbers (usually between four and six digits) that are used to access the device or system. A smart phone, for instance, comes with PIN codes that the user must enter each time they use the device. PIN codes are also commonly used to safeguard ATM or transactions at POS,[1] secure access control (doors computers, doors, cars),[2] computer systems,[3] and internet transactions.

While a longer PIN code may appear more secure, there are ways to hack or guess the PIN code just four digits long. It is recommended that the PIN should be at least six digits long using a mix of numbers and letters, to provide more security.
